Hi, I've been looking around on the forums and the web and I have this question:
How do I create a system image/boot drive of my SSD (128 GB) as well as a backup of my HDD (1 TB)? I use the HDD for games, editing software, and file storage, and I use the SSD for windows and some programs. I have a WD My Passport (1.5 TB)
Also, what program would you recommend to do the backup?
Thank you!
 
Solution


Macrium Reflect does specifically this. An image of the C SSD, and an image of the HDD.
2 images, each on their own schedule, or however you want to set it up.

Assuming you have a target drive large enough.
